What are the effects and functions of Poria cocos peel

What are the effects and functions of Poria cocos peel

Poria peel is a medicinal material. Like Poria cocos, this medicinal material can also help treat many diseases. Poria peel is sweet and neutral in nature, and is usually decocted in water when taken. Poria cocos skin looks different from Poria cocos. The outside of Poria cocos skin is dark, mostly brown, usually tan or black brown, while the inside is lighter, some are white and some are gray-brown. Moreover, the texture of Poria cocos skin is relatively soft and elastic, so it is relatively easy to distinguish from the outside.

1. Spleen deficiency, diarrhea and leukorrhea

Poria can both strengthen the spleen and eliminate dampness. It can treat both the symptoms and the root cause of diarrhea and leucorrhea caused by spleen deficiency and dysfunction. It is often used in combination with Codonopsis pilosula, Atractylodes macrocephala, and Dioscorea opposita. It can be used as an auxiliary medicine for nourishing the lungs and spleen and treating qi deficiency.

2. Phlegm and cough

Phlegm and dampness enter the meridians, causing sore shoulders and back. Poria can not only promote diuresis and eliminate dampness, but also has the effect of strengthening the spleen. It has a therapeutic effect on the symptoms of spleen deficiency, which is unable to transport and transform water and dampness, and its accumulation and transformation into phlegm and fluid. It can be used together with Pinellia and dried tangerine peel, or with cinnamon twig and Atractylodes macrocephala. It can be used together with Pinellia ternata and Citrus aurantium to treat phlegm and dampness entering the meridians, shoulder and back pain.

3. Palpitations, insomnia, etc.

Poria can nourish the heart and soothe the mind, so it can be used for symptoms such as restlessness, palpitations, and insomnia. It is often used in combination with ginseng, polygala, and spinach seed.

The main effect of Poria peel is to eliminate edema and act as a diuretic. In Chinese medicine, it means promoting diuresis and reducing swelling. Patients with difficulty urinating can try this medicinal material. Patients with edema can also use Poria cocos peel to treat edema. However, it is recommended to take it under the guidance of a doctor.
